Overview: -Estimated trophy difficulty: 7/10 Platinum Difficulty Rating - PlaystationTrophies.org -Offline breakdown: 46 (34(B) 11(S) 1(G)) -Online breakdown 3 (3(B)) However, many more trophies are easiest done online. - Unobtainable. -Approximate time to : 26-35hrs+ -Minimum number of playthroughs needed: 1 -Number of missable trophies: 0, none. -Glitched trophies: 2; Chanteuse, Sampler Plate. -Do cheat codes disable trophies? No. Introduction: "Chanteuse" may be a glitched trophy, depending on whether you get 100% of the notes on the song, or if you get 6/5 gold/non gold stars. These somehow conflict with each other. For "Sampler Plate," you may not get credit for achieving the trophy even though you've played through every game mode. If you've played through them all and it hasn't unlocked, play them all again and it should unlock. Walkthrough: Step 1: Career Mode Simply go through career and play all of the songs, while attempting to get 5/6 stars on the songs and possibly even complete a few challenges while going through the set. This should net you a majority of the trophies in the game. Step 2: Multiplayer - Boost/find other players in order to get the trophies. - Unobtainable This can be most helpful with getting band challenges if you cannot earn the trophies locally with your nearby friends. This should net you a lot of stars and challenges, and should also be mostly looking out for the 3 online-only trophies. You should also be concerned about getting the "4 of each instrument" trophy too if you cannot accomplish that by yourself. Find the boosting thread for this game at this link: Trophy Boosting Thread (Read First Post!) - PlaystationTrophies.org Step 3: Cleanup Go through career and get any remaining stars you need by doing challenges and scoring as many stars on songs as you possibly can. It is also a good time to play 300 songs in quick play if needed. The easiest method for getting 300 songs in quickplay is by creating 10 songs in the music studio that consist of one short 3 second note, and making a setlist of these 10 songs and playing them in a setlist over and over until the trophy unlocks. This should get you the trophy much quicker then trying to play 300 normal songs over a long period of time. Edited February 17, 2020 by Terminator Added server closure notices.
